OrientDB 提供了多種方法來驗證數據導入是否成功。以下是一些建議的步驟:
使用 SQL 查詢檢查數據: 在 OrientDB 中,您可以使用 SQL 查詢來檢查數據是否已正確導入。例如,如果您導入了一個名為 “MyClass” 的類,可以使用以下查詢來檢查數據:
SELECT COUNT(*) FROM MyClass;
這將返回 “MyClass” 中的記錄數。您還可以使用其他查詢來驗證數據的完整性和準確性。
使用 OrientDB Studio: OrientDB Studio 是一個圖形界面工具,可以幫助您查看和操作數據庫。在 Studio 中,您可以導航到您的數據庫,然后展開 “Classes”、“Documents” 或 “Edges” 節點以查看導入的數據。通過查看數據,您可以手動驗證數據是否正確導入。
使用 OrientDB Java API:
如果您正在使用 Java 編寫應用程序來導入數據,可以使用 OrientDB Java API 提供的功能來驗證數據。例如,您可以使用 ODatabaseDocument
類的 count()
方法來計算 “MyClass” 中的記錄數:
ODatabaseDocument db = new ODatabaseDocument("remote:localhost/mydb");
db.open("admin", "password");
int count = db.getMetadata().getSchema().getClass("MyClass").count();
System.out.println("Number of records in MyClass: " + count);
使用 OrientDB REST API: 如果您正在使用 REST API 導入數據,可以使用 HTTP 請求來檢查數據是否已成功導入。例如,您可以向以下 URL 發送一個 GET 請求來獲取 “MyClass” 中的記錄數:
http://localhost:2480/mydb/class/MyClass/count
然后,您可以解析響應中的 JSON 數據以獲取記錄數。
使用自定義驗證腳本: 您可以根據您的需求編寫自定義腳本來驗證數據導入。例如,您可以使用 Python、Java 或 Node.js 等編程語言編寫腳本,該腳本可以連接到 OrientDB 數據庫并執行查詢以驗證數據的完整性和準確性。
總之,OrientDB 提供了多種方法來驗證數據導入是否成功。您可以根據您的需求和場景選擇最適合您的方法。